andrewas 02-22-2004 11:38 AM

Yo shouldn't be starting BG1 at all from what I can tell, BGtutu puts the BG1 content into the BG2 engine, so you should be starting BG2. And you will have to start a new game since there were changes to the save format between Bg1 and BG2, and as far as I can tell there is no conversion done by BGtutu.
